Layin' da SmackDown - SmackDown recap for May 26, 2023

Austin Theory retains the WWE United States Championship against Sheamus. During the match, Theory grabs a chair as Sheamus goes for a Brogue Kick, and afterwards, Pretty Deadly (Kit Wilson and Elton Prince) show up and get involved. As Sheamus hits Kit Wilson with the Ten Beats of the Bodhrain, Theory retains with a schoolkid pin. After the match, Butch and Ridge Holland chase Pretty Deadly into the crowd.



Backstage, The Bloodline meet in Roman Reigns' dressing room. Paul Heyman tells The Usos (Jimmy and Jey Uso) that Roman Reigns will be making it up to them by inviting them to Roman's 1,000-day reign celebration next week. Roman says he wants the entire family there, including Jey, but does not mention Jimmy. As Jimmy takes offense and tris to leave, Roman tells him to sit down. Jimmy stays standing up, and Roman dares him to do something, saying he could whup him then and can whup him now and that he will respect, obey and acknowledge him before telling him to leave. Jey leaves along with Jimmy.



Raquel Rodriguez and Shotzi beat Damage CTRL (Bayley and Iyo Sky) when Iyo Sky's top rope senton can't break Raquel's pinfall attempt on Bayley.



We see video packages for Seth "Freakin'" Rollins and "The Phenomenal One" AJ Styles before their match for the new WWE World Heavyweight Championship at Night of Champions.

Cameron Grimes beats Ashante "Thee" Adonis. After the match, Cameron Grimes is attacked out of nowhere from behind by Baron Corbin.



Bianca Belair heads to the ring. Bianca talks about her championship match with Asuka at Night of Champions, and says it is against a different Asuka from who she knew and does not respect. She says that Asuka wants more than her title, and if she wanted a rematch, all she had to do was ask; instead, Asuka showed up in her hometown and misted her in front of her family and friends, then nearly did it again when she tried to help Zelina Vega. While the blue mist is still affecting her a little bit, her mind has never been more clear, and she is not giving Asuka a rematch, but a fight, at Night of Champions, until she retains her title. Suddenly, Asuka's entrance music hits, but Bianca is attacked from behind by Asuka, who puts her in a cross arm breaker until officials go after her. Asuka soon rushes at Bianca again, and throws Asuka into the officials with a K.O.D., which allows Asuka to run away.



The Street Profits (Angelo Dawkins and Montez Ford) guest on commentary for the next match.

LA Knight beats Rick Boogs after raking Boogs' eyes before hitting the BFT. After the match, LA Knight threatens to beat The Street Profits (Angelo Dawkins and Montez Ford) up for talking trash about him, then says that he took the trash out with Rick Boogs and that the Profits' time is coming.



Scarlett holds a tarot card with "The Phenomenal" AJ Styles on it as Karrion Kross says an arrogant man sees one road in front of him but not the danger that lies in wait, then says Styles should be asking himself what condition he will be in after Kross victimizes him.

We see a video package for Isla Dawn and Alba Fyre.

"The Phenomenal" AJ Styles beats Karrion Kross. During the match, Scarlett grabs Styles from the outside of the ring, but she is chased around and to the back by "Michin" Mia Yim.



Backstage, Kayla Braxton interviews "The Phenomenal" AJ Styles, who says that Seth "Freakin'" Rollins can be what he wants, but only he can be phenomenal and he will put a phenomenal beating to become WWE World Heavyweight Champion.



It's time for The Kevin Owens Show. Tonight's guests are Roman Reigns and Solo Sikoa after Owens declares it "The Kevin and Sami Show." Paul Heyman suddenly shows up and says that Roman Reigns only shows up when he wants to, then The Usos (Jimmy and Jey Uso) show up. Jey says he and Jimmy did not forget what Kevin and Sami did to them last week, and that Kevin and Sami have a bigger problem in front of them. Owens says he wanted to talk to The Usos anyway. Owens says he does not get why Sami cares about The Usos, but he feels The Usos deserve better. He says Sami was right has been right about that and how Roman has treated them, as The Usos are the heart of Roman's table. He then says that Roman uses The Usos and treats them as "the appendix of the table" as if they were expendable and have gone from the greatest tag team to Roman's errand boys, but Jimmy Uso says that as far as things go, he is the Tribal Chief. Roman Reigns' entrance theme immediately hits, then Roman confronts The Usos and tosses the microphons out of The Usos' hands. Sami asks Roman if he knows that The Bloodline is collapsing and if it is all his fault. When Roman knocks the microphone out of Sami's hand, Owens hits Roman with a Stunner, starting a brawl. Solo Sikoa shows up and lays out Owens and Sami, then tosses Sami into a Spear by Roman Reigns.
